What If I Can’t Go Back to Work?
Your workers’ compensation benefits should cover all reasonable and necessary medical costs. However, workers’ compensation insurers often deny medical coverage that injured employees need to make the fullest recovery possible. They may even try to end benefits by alleging you are at “maximum medical improvement” when you and your doctors know you aren’t.
If you can’t make a full recovery, you may be eligible for a permanent partial disability benefit. It helps to have a workers’ comp lawyer serving Bemidji, Minnesota to ensure that you get all of the benefits you are entitled to.
